    Hello Will,

    Nice patch. This is probably a commemorative patch which has been done for the 85th Anniversary of the Escadrille La Fayette (1916); since 1947 named the Escadron 2/4 La Fayette. By now, composed of the N124 (Indian Head), the SPA 167 (Stork) and SPA 160 (Red Devils).
